GAME RECAP

Cleveland Barons (MM) outlasts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M), 3-2

Troy Sports 4    Mon, Dec 30, 2013

Cleveland Barons (MM) and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) were evenly matched throughout their contest, but Cleveland Barons (MM) made the most of its opportunities and won, 3-2.

No lead was more than one goal during the contest, and the winning goal was scored by William Harrison at 17:10 of the third period.

Cleveland Barons (MM) was led by Harrison, who registered one goal and one assist.

Cleveland Barons (MM) managed to stay out of the box better than usual, registering one minor for two minutes in penalty time. Cleveland Barons (MM) ended up below its season average of 11.0 penalty minutes per game. Cleveland Barons (MM) forced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) goalie Matthew Sawyer to work between the pipes, taking 36 shots.

Cleveland Barons (MM) also had goals scored by Austin Kamer and Gordie Myer, who each put in one. In addition, Cleveland Barons (MM) received assists from Scott Donahue, who had two and Grant Meyer, Andrew Noel, and Max Rasberg, who contributed one a piece.

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) managed to stay out of the box better than usual, totaling one minor for two minutes in penalty time.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) finished below its season average of 16.0 penalty minutes per game.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) kept Cleveland Barons (MM)'s goalie busy throughout the game, and Andrew Lee made 30 saves on 32 shots.

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) was helped by Jack Krolak, who finished with one goal. Krolak scored 6:38 into the first period to make the score 1-1. George Rajak picked up the assist. Luke Novak also scored for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M). Other players who recorded assists for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) were Mickey Capek, Brock Thompson, and Eric Bolden, who each chipped in one.

Cleveland Barons (MM) registered zero goals on one power play opportunities.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M)'s Sawyer stopped 33 shots out of the 36 that he faced. Milwaukee Jr. Admirals (MM) registered zero goals on one power play opportunities.
